Next-Gen Image Optimization & Compression

Lanista employs advanced image formats like WebP and AVIF, which provide superior compression compared to older JPEG or PNG files without losing visual quality. This means the thumbnail files sent to a player’s device in Halifax or Calgary are significantly smaller in size, enabling faster downloads. Furthermore, the platform leverages responsive image techniques, delivering different thumbnail sizes based on the user’s screen resolution. A player on a mobile device in a Montreal café receives a perfectly sharp but smaller file than someone on a 4K desktop monitor, guaranteeing no bandwidth is wasted.

International Content Delivery Network (CDN) Strategy

For Canadian users, physical distance from game servers can cause latency. Lanista mitigates this by using a robust global Content Delivery Network (CDN). Thumbnail images are cached on servers located strategically placed around the world, including multiple points within Canada itself. When a player loads the lobby, their request is routed to the nearest CDN server, often in Toronto or Vancouver, rather than a central server perhaps thousands of kilometers away. This geographical proximity slashes loading times, making the experience feel local and instantaneous.
